Job Rotation. 2.11.1 It is a condition of employment that all Employees perform duties and functions for which they have the skills and training to perform and that they are prepared to undertake training to perform tasks outside their usual duties 2.11.2 Subject to subclauses 2.11.3 and 2.11.4, Employees who work at higher level duties will be paid at the rate of pay for the higher level for the time worked at those higher level duties. 2.11.3 Where Employees request to perform work in a lower level they will be paid at the rate appropriate for that lower for the hours worked at that lower level. 2.11.4 Should the Employer offer the opportunity to be cross-trained in higher level duties then the Employee shall be paid the existing level (lower) rate until the Employee is deemed competent to perform at the higher level.
